On the other hand, early Subdue Animal on a scout gives some silly powerful units for the era. Especially on marathon maps. The first barbs are 1 and 2 str, but Tigers, Lions, and Bears (oh my) have 3 and 4 str. Plus these units, especially the spider, are sickly useful in torturing your opponents by sniping off scouts, workers, etc.
A nearly foolproof way to capture a spider with a scout: Combat I, Subdue, Woodsman, Guerilla(only 17 exp total), and find a spider next to a wooded hill. Congrats on your new spider next turn. Early in 0.20 the poison meant going to a friendly city to heal, now you can heal on your own.
